MATTER OF SHANNON v. FISCHER

510739.

84 A.D.3d 1614 (2011)

923 N.Y.S.2d 317

In the Matter of JESSE SHANNON, Petitioner, v. BRIAN FISCHER, as Commissioner of Correctional Services, Respondent.

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of New York, Third Department.

Decided May 19, 2011.


While approximately 27 inmates were exiting the company for their evening meal, a fight broke out between two of them and all of the inmates were given a direct order to return to their cells and lock in. Many of the inmates did not comply and remained out of their cells, contributing to the disturbance.
